Simplicity

CycleHigh
NomadHigh

A single binary makes initial installation simple, but achieving a production-ready state requires integrating and configuring external tools like Consul and Vault.

Customizability

CycleHigh
NomadHigh

Provides highly flexible workload scheduling capable of running containers, standalone binaries, and VMs across varied infrastructure topologies.

Operational Burden

CycleMinimal
NomadModerate

Requires self-managing the underlying hosts, network meshes, and the operational lifecycle of the entire HashiCorp stack.
